ElementUI的 Select 直接使用 el-select / el-option 标签即可,属性 v-model 表示该下拉框绑定的对象,即最终选择的值会赋给该对象,直接用于 el-select 标签,el-option 标签直接用来遍历可选数据,然后做展示,其中 label 属性为选项展示的文本信息,value 为该选项的值,代码如下所示: 代码语言:javascript 复制 <te...
element-ui api文档上说,select的v-model值只能是boolean/number/string,虽然对象不在此列,其实是可以绑定对象的。 要实现绑定对象,只需要两步,第一,option标签上value绑定对象。第二,在select标签上,声明value-key,它是option value对象的唯一标识属性,通常是id、code之类的,注意value-key是字符串类型,如果v-model...
label }}</el-option> </el-select> :value="item"传值设置为item对象,v-model="currentItem"接收绑定对象,value-key="_index"中的_index是item选项数据中的字段,当前对象中的唯一值,作为value唯一标识的键名,可根据业务替换成对象中的id, @change="selectChanged"监听选择currentItem变化。 selectChanged(...
element-UI 的 el-select 组件里,当 v-model 绑定为对象类型,并对其设定默认值 <el-selectv-model="form.InWindowPositionType"><el-optionv-for="item in positionList":value="item.value":key="item.value":label='item.label'></el-option></el-select> 在data 中设 form.InWindowPositionType 与 ...
使用select绑定对象时,我们会出现这样的一个问题: 1.options列表展现出来的数据全部都是蓝色的; 2.select的value值在给默认值得情况下,展示的不是默认值,而是options中的随机一个 3. 或者是展示不正常的 此时,就需要看看官方文档的说明了 我们需要在select上加上 value-key这属性;默认值是value;当我们提供的选择...
将el-select 绑定属性 value-key (作为 value 唯一标识的键名,绑定值为对象类型时必填)再将 el-option 的 value 属性绑定之为 item
<template><div><el-selectv-model="value"value-key="value"@change="change"placeholder="请选择"><el-optionv-for="item in options":key="item.value":label="`${item.label}`":value="item"><!--绑定整个对象item-->{{item.label}}</el-option></el-select></div></template><script>export...
value-key作为 value 唯一标识的键名,绑定值为对象类型时必填string—value 所以我们要在el-select 标签里面加上 value-key="id"( id是选项数据的字段) <el-select v-model="value" placeholder="请选择" @change="getchang" value-key="id" >
element-ui中select组件v-model绑定值为对象时的处理 对于下拉组件,当有时,不只需要select中的value,还需要使⽤其他信息如id,那么,可以使v-model绑定的值是⼀个对象,并加上value-key属性,依旧可以实现默认值对应。另外,如果数据库中存的只是value,⽽不是id,那么将value值设置为value,⽽不是id,...
VUE element-UI 的 el-select 绑定对象类型,设置初始值,不能正确显示 2018-10-12 10:14 −... 晨の风 0 27627 element-ui里el-form的lable颜色怎么修改? 2019-12-23 09:35 −就是把style改写成全局的,不要scoped(注意class,id的唯一,不要影响了整体布局) 链接:https://segmentfault.com/q/101000001...